Types of Temporary Status

DEFERRED ACTION FOR CHILDHOOD ARRIVALS (DACA)

An American immigration policy that allowed some individuals who entered the country as minors, and had either entered or remained in the country illegally, to receive a renewable two-year period of deferred action from deportation and to be eligible for a work permit.

B1 VISA

A B1 Visitor Visa is a nonimmigrant visa for persons who want to enter the United States temporarily for business.

F-1 STUDENT VISA

The F-1 Student Visa is a nonimmigrant visa for those wishing to attend a university or college, high school, private elementary school, seminary, conservatory, language training program, or other academic institution in the United States.

TEMPORARY PROTECTIVE STATUS (TPS)

Foreign nationals from certain countries around the world have been granted Temporary Protected Status by the United States. When the Secretary of Homeland Security grants TPS to a country, the intentions are generally to protect foreign nationals from dangerous conditions in their country of origin.

HUMANITARIAN PAROLE

Parole allows an individual who may be inadmissible or otherwise ineligible for admission into the United States to be in the United States for a temporary period for urgent humanitarian reasons or significant public benefit. You may apply for humanitarian parole if you have a compelling emergency and there is an urgent humanitarian reason or significant public benefit to allowing you to temporarily enter the United States. Anyone can file an application for humanitarian parole.

UNITING FOR UKRAINE

Uniting for Ukraine provides a pathway for displaced Ukrainian citizens and their immediate family members who are outside the United States to come to the United States and stay temporarily for a two-year period of parole.

PROCESS FOR CUBANS,HAITIANS, NICARAGUANS AND VENEZUELANS

DHS has implemented processes through which nationals of Cuba, Haiti, Nicaragua, and Venezuela, and their qualifying immediate family members, may request to come to the United States in a safe and orderly way.
